Tìm việc xin chào các anh chị và các bạn cùng đến với cẩm nang tìm việc của timviec.net.vn “10 Chân Trời Sáng Tạo” là một ý tưởng rất thú vị và đầy tiềm năng để định hướng phát triển nguồn nhân lực IT. Dưới đây là mô tả chi tiết về 10 lĩnh vực sáng tạo này, tập trung vào vai trò và kỹ năng cần thiết của nhân lực IT trong mỗi lĩnh vực:
1. Trí Tuệ Nhân Tạo (AI) và Học Máy (Machine Learning):
Mô tả:
Phát triển các hệ thống và thuật toán cho phép máy tính học hỏi từ dữ liệu, đưa ra quyết định và thực hiện các tác vụ thông minh.
Vai trò của Nhân lực IT:
Kỹ sư AI/ML:
Xây dựng, triển khai và duy trì các mô hình AI/ML.
Nhà khoa học dữ liệu:
Thu thập, phân tích và trực quan hóa dữ liệu để huấn luyện các mô hình AI.
Kỹ sư học sâu (Deep Learning):
Chuyên về các mạng nơ-ron sâu và các thuật toán phức tạp.
Kỹ sư MLOps:
Tự động hóa và quản lý vòng đời của các mô hình ML từ phát triển đến triển khai và giám sát.
Kỹ năng cần thiết:
Lập trình: Python (TensorFlow, PyTorch, scikit-learn), Java, R.
Toán học: Đại số tuyến tính, giải tích, xác suất thống kê.
Hiểu biết về các thuật toán ML, DL.
Kỹ năng xử lý và phân tích dữ liệu.
Kỹ năng giải quyết vấn đề và tư duy phản biện.
2. Internet Vạn Vật (IoT):
Mô tả:
Kết nối các thiết bị vật lý với internet, cho phép chúng thu thập, trao đổi và phân tích dữ liệu.
Vai trò của Nhân lực IT:
Kỹ sư IoT:
Thiết kế, phát triển và triển khai các giải pháp IoT.
Kỹ sư phần mềm nhúng:
Lập trình cho các thiết bị IoT (vi điều khiển, cảm biến).
Chuyên gia bảo mật IoT:
Đảm bảo an ninh cho các thiết bị và hệ thống IoT.
Chuyên gia phân tích dữ liệu IoT:
Xử lý và phân tích dữ liệu từ các thiết bị IoT để đưa ra thông tin chi tiết.
Kỹ năng cần thiết:
Lập trình: C, C++, Python, Java.
Hiểu biết về kiến trúc IoT.
Kiến thức về mạng và giao thức truyền thông (MQTT, CoAP).
Kinh nghiệm làm việc với các nền tảng IoT (AWS IoT, Azure IoT, Google Cloud IoT).
Kỹ năng bảo mật.
3. Blockchain và Web3:
Mô tả:
Phát triển các ứng dụng phi tập trung dựa trên công nghệ blockchain, tạo ra một thế giới internet minh bạch và an toàn hơn.
Vai trò của Nhân lực IT:
Nhà phát triển Blockchain:
Xây dựng các ứng dụng phi tập trung (dApps) và hợp đồng thông minh (smart contracts).
Kỹ sư Blockchain:
Thiết kế và triển khai các mạng blockchain.
Chuyên gia bảo mật Blockchain:
Đảm bảo an ninh cho các hệ thống blockchain.
Nhà phát triển Web3:
Xây dựng các ứng dụng web mới dựa trên công nghệ blockchain.
Kỹ năng cần thiết:
Lập trình: Solidity, Go, Rust, JavaScript.
Hiểu biết về kiến trúc blockchain, các giao thức đồng thuận.
Kinh nghiệm làm việc với các nền tảng blockchain (Ethereum, Binance Smart Chain, Solana).
Kiến thức về mật mã học.
Kỹ năng bảo mật.
4. Điện Toán Đám Mây (Cloud Computing):
Mô tả:
Cung cấp các dịch vụ điện toán (máy chủ, lưu trữ, cơ sở dữ liệu, phần mềm) qua internet.
Vai trò của Nhân lực IT:
Kỹ sư Cloud:
Thiết kế, triển khai và quản lý các hệ thống trên nền tảng đám mây.
Kiến trúc sư Cloud:
Xây dựng các kiến trúc giải pháp đám mây phù hợp với nhu cầu của doanh nghiệp.
Chuyên gia DevOps:
Tự động hóa quy trình phát triển và triển khai ứng dụng trên đám mây.
Chuyên gia bảo mật Cloud:
Đảm bảo an ninh cho các hệ thống và dữ liệu trên đám mây.
Kỹ năng cần thiết:
Hiểu biết về các nền tảng đám mây (AWS, Azure, Google Cloud).
Kinh nghiệm làm việc với các dịch vụ đám mây (EC2, S3, Azure VMs, Google Compute Engine).
Kỹ năng tự động hóa (Ansible, Terraform, CloudFormation).
Kiến thức về mạng và bảo mật.
Kỹ năng lập trình (Python, Java, Go).
5. An Ninh Mạng (Cybersecurity):
Mô tả:
Bảo vệ hệ thống máy tính, mạng và dữ liệu khỏi các mối đe dọa an ninh mạng.
Vai trò của Nhân lực IT:
Chuyên gia an ninh mạng:
Phát hiện, ngăn chặn và ứng phó với các cuộc tấn công mạng.
Kỹ sư bảo mật:
Thiết kế và triển khai các giải pháp bảo mật.
Nhà phân tích an ninh:
Phân tích các mối đe dọa và lỗ hổng bảo mật.
Chuyên gia kiểm thử xâm nhập (Penetration Tester):
Kiểm tra tính bảo mật của hệ thống bằng cách mô phỏng các cuộc tấn công.
Kỹ năng cần thiết:
Hiểu biết về các mối đe dọa an ninh mạng.
Kiến thức về các công cụ và kỹ thuật bảo mật.
Kỹ năng phân tích và giải quyết vấn đề.
Kỹ năng lập trình (Python, C, C++).
Kinh nghiệm làm việc với các hệ thống bảo mật (SIEM, IDS/IPS).
6. Phát Triển Phần Mềm (Software Development):
Mô tả:
Thiết kế, phát triển, kiểm thử và triển khai các ứng dụng phần mềm.
Vai trò của Nhân lực IT:
Nhà phát triển phần mềm:
Viết mã, kiểm thử và sửa lỗi phần mềm.
Kiến trúc sư phần mềm:
Thiết kế kiến trúc tổng thể của hệ thống phần mềm.
Kỹ sư kiểm thử phần mềm (QA/QC):
Đảm bảo chất lượng của phần mềm.
Chuyên gia DevOps:
Tự động hóa quy trình phát triển và triển khai phần mềm.
Kỹ năng cần thiết:
Lập trình: Java, Python, C, JavaScript, Go.
Hiểu biết về các phương pháp phát triển phần mềm (Agile, Scrum, Waterfall).
Kỹ năng thiết kế và phân tích hệ thống.
Kỹ năng làm việc nhóm và giao tiếp.
Kinh nghiệm làm việc với các công cụ quản lý mã nguồn (Git).
7. Dữ Liệu Lớn (Big Data) và Phân Tích Dữ Liệu:
Mô tả:
Thu thập, lưu trữ, xử lý và phân tích lượng lớn dữ liệu để đưa ra các thông tin chi tiết hữu ích.
Vai trò của Nhân lực IT:
Kỹ sư dữ liệu:
Xây dựng và quản lý các hệ thống lưu trữ và xử lý dữ liệu lớn.
Nhà khoa học dữ liệu:
Phân tích dữ liệu để tìm ra các xu hướng và thông tin chi tiết.
Chuyên gia trực quan hóa dữ liệu:
Tạo ra các biểu đồ và báo cáo trực quan để trình bày dữ liệu.
Chuyên gia khai thác dữ liệu (Data Mining):
Sử dụng các thuật toán để khám phá các mẫu trong dữ liệu.
Kỹ năng cần thiết:
Lập trình: Python, Java, Scala.
Hiểu biết về các công nghệ Big Data (Hadoop, Spark, Kafka).
Kỹ năng SQL và NoSQL.
Kỹ năng phân tích thống kê.
Kỹ năng trực quan hóa dữ liệu (Tableau, Power BI).
8. Thực Tế Ảo (VR) và Thực Tế Tăng Cường (AR):
Mô tả:
Tạo ra các trải nghiệm tương tác ảo và tăng cường trải nghiệm thực tế bằng cách sử dụng công nghệ máy tính.
Vai trò của Nhân lực IT:
Nhà phát triển VR/AR:
Xây dựng các ứng dụng VR/AR.
Nhà thiết kế trải nghiệm VR/AR (UX/UI):
Thiết kế giao diện và trải nghiệm người dùng cho các ứng dụng VR/AR.
Kỹ sư đồ họa:
Tạo ra các mô hình 3D và hiệu ứng hình ảnh cho các ứng dụng VR/AR.
Chuyên gia tương tác người-máy (HCI):
Nghiên cứu và phát triển các phương pháp tương tác tự nhiên trong môi trường VR/AR.
Kỹ năng cần thiết:
Lập trình: C, C++, Python.
Hiểu biết về các công cụ phát triển VR/AR (Unity, Unreal Engine).
Kiến thức về đồ họa máy tính và hình học 3D.
Kỹ năng thiết kế UX/UI.
Kỹ năng làm việc với các thiết bị VR/AR (Oculus Rift, HTC Vive, HoloLens).
9. Tự Động Hóa Quy Trình Bằng Robot (RPA):
Mô tả:
Sử dụng robot phần mềm để tự động hóa các tác vụ lặp đi lặp lại và dựa trên quy tắc.
Vai trò của Nhân lực IT:
Nhà phát triển RPA:
Thiết kế và triển khai các robot phần mềm.
Nhà phân tích quy trình:
Xác định các quy trình có thể tự động hóa.
Chuyên gia quản lý RPA:
Quản lý và giám sát các robot phần mềm.
Kỹ năng cần thiết:
Hiểu biết về các công cụ RPA (UiPath, Automation Anywhere, Blue Prism).
Kỹ năng lập trình cơ bản.
Kỹ năng phân tích quy trình.
Kỹ năng giải quyết vấn đề.
10. Phát Triển Bền Vững (Sustainable Development) và Công Nghệ Xanh (Green Technology):
Mô tả:
Sử dụng công nghệ để giải quyết các vấn đề môi trường và xã hội, tạo ra một tương lai bền vững hơn.
Vai trò của Nhân lực IT:
Nhà phát triển phần mềm cho năng lượng tái tạo:
Xây dựng các ứng dụng để quản lý và tối ưu hóa các nguồn năng lượng tái tạo.
Chuyên gia phân tích dữ liệu môi trường:
Sử dụng dữ liệu để theo dõi và dự đoán các vấn đề môi trường.
Kỹ sư IoT cho nông nghiệp thông minh:
Phát triển các giải pháp IoT để tối ưu hóa việc sử dụng tài nguyên trong nông nghiệp.
Nhà phát triển ứng dụng cho giáo dục và y tế:
Xây dựng các ứng dụng để cải thiện chất lượng giáo dục và chăm sóc sức khỏe.
Kỹ năng cần thiết:
Lập trình: Python, Java, C++.
Hiểu biết về các vấn đề môi trường và xã hội.
Kỹ năng phân tích dữ liệu.
Kỹ năng IoT.
Kỹ năng làm việc với các công nghệ năng lượng tái tạo.
Lưu ý:
Đây chỉ là một cái nhìn tổng quan về 10 chân trời sáng tạo này. Mỗi lĩnh vực đều có nhiều chuyên môn và vai trò khác nhau.
Kỹ năng cần thiết có thể thay đổi tùy thuộc vào yêu cầu cụ thể của từng dự án và công ty.
Việc học hỏi và cập nhật kiến thức liên tục là rất quan trọng trong lĩnh vực IT, đặc biệt là trong các lĩnh vực sáng tạo và mới nổi.
Hy vọng mô tả chi tiết này sẽ giúp bạn hiểu rõ hơn về 10 chân trời sáng tạo và vai trò của nhân lực IT trong mỗi lĩnh vực. Chúc bạn thành công trên con đường sự nghiệp của mình!